A vasectomy is a male birth control method that stops your semen from receiving sperm. The tubes that contain the sperm are cut and sealed to complete the process. Vasectomy is generally performed under local anesthetic in an outpatient environment with minimal risk of complications.

You must be certain that you do not wish to father children in the future before undergoing a vasectomy. Vasectomy should be regarded as a permanent method of male birth control, even though it can be reversed.

Refusing to have sex is the only way to prevent becoming pregnant. On the other hand, extremely few vasectomy procedures fail. Around 1 in 10,000 times after a vasectomy, sperm may be able to pass through the divided ends of the vas deferens. For many years, vasectomy has been a reliable and safe technique of birth control. Following a vasectomy, semen samples are regularly examined to ensure the treatment is effective. You could need a second vasectomy if sperm are still present in your semen samples.

As directed by your physician, stop taking NSAIDs and blood thinners prior to a vasectomy. You should also speak with your doctor regarding diabetes drugs. To minimize swelling, wear tight-fitting underwear or an athletic supporter. Take a thorough shower and remove any scrotal hair as directed. To prevent pressure on the surgical site following the treatment, make arrangements for someone to drive you home.

A vasectomy involves cutting and closing the vas deferens to prevent sperm from combining with semen. There are two types: no-scalpel vasectomy, which involves a tiny puncture rather than a cut, and incision vasectomy, which involves microscopic incisions in the scrotum. In both procedures, a tiny portion of the vas deferens is grasped, cut, tied, and cauterized; your testicles and other reproductive organs are left intact.

The process usually takes urologists fifteen minutes or less. However, it might be even quicker.

The majority of patients recover rapidly following a vasectomy. For a few days, you might have minor bruising, swelling, or soreness. Wearing tight underwear or a scrotal support, using ice packs, and resting can help. For approximately a week, refrain from sexual activity and heavy lifting, and adhere to your doctor's wound care and follow-up recommendations.

Vasectomy has a success rate of over 99.8% and is almost 100% successful at preventing pregnancy. It's crucial to remember that all of the remaining sperm must clear out 8–12 weeks following the surgery.

Process Involved for Vasectomy in Turkey

  • Consultation: Talk to a urologist or family planning specialist about the risks and effectiveness of the procedure.
  • Preoperative evaluation: To ensure the patient's health during the procedure, review the patient's medical history, have a thorough discussion regarding the choice, and perform a physical examination.
  • Discussing Treatment: Explain the procedure for a vasectomy, any potential adverse side effects, and future risk of infertility.
  • Planning for a Surgery: Discuss the anesthesia options, the type of vasectomy (traditional or no-scalpel), and aftercare recommendations.
  • Postoperative Follow-up: Check for any complications, ensure that the healing process is going smoothly, and utilise repeat semen tests as a follow-up to confirm the success of treatment.
